Struct windows_sys::Win32::Graphics::Printing::PORT_DATA_2
[−]#[repr(C)]pub struct PORT_DATA_2 {Show 14 fields
pub sztPortName: [u16; 64],
pub dwVersion: u32,
pub dwProtocol: u32,
pub cbSize: u32,
pub dwReserved: u32,
pub sztHostAddress: [u16; 128],
pub sztSNMPCommunity: [u16; 33],
pub dwDoubleSpool: u32,
pub sztQueue: [u16; 33],
pub Reserved: [u8; 514],
pub dwPortNumber: u32,
pub dwSNMPEnabled: u32,
pub dwSNMPDevIndex: u32,
pub dwPortMonitorMibIndex: u32,
}
Expand description
Required features: ‘Win32_Graphics_Printing’
Fields
sztPortName: [u16; 64]
dwVersion: u32
dwProtocol: u32
cbSize: u32
dwReserved: u32
sztHostAddress: [u16; 128]
sztSNMPCommunity: [u16; 33]
dwDoubleSpool: u32
sztQueue: [u16; 33]
Reserved: [u8; 514]
dwPortNumber: u32
dwSNMPEnabled: u32
dwSNMPDevIndex: u32
dwPortMonitorMibIndex: u32
Trait Implementations
impl Clone for PORT_DATA_2
impl Clone for PORT_DATA_2
impl Copy for PORT_DATA_2
Auto Trait Implementations
impl RefUnwindSafe for PORT_DATA_2
impl Send for PORT_DATA_2
impl Sync for PORT_DATA_2
impl Unpin for PORT_DATA_2
impl UnwindSafe for PORT_DATA_2
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cepub fn borrow_mut(&mut self) -> &mut T
pub f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more